> > this is the first song released from a small live show that I recorded
> > recently.
> > The Band is "Shivat Zion", an Israeli Reggae band.
> >
> > https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=KZS57xoBET4
> >
> > Everything was done with Linux software.
> >
> > Software I used:
> >
> > Arch Linux
> > Ardour 3
> > Calf Lv2 effects (several)
> > GxZita_reverb   (which I just recently discovered, and what should I
> > say... what a sweeet sounding reverb, new favorite)
> > Also played around with the new meters.lv2 bundle, I think though that I
> > didn't get the full idea of R128 yet.
> > Invada Dynamics processing
> > TAP
> >
> >
> > Everything regarding the Video work was done by my brother Michael.
> > He used KDEnlive to edit the video, also on an Arch machine.
